Margaret Peterson Haddix in the US-school canon
Margaret Peterson Haddix contributes 4 titles to the US-school assigned-reading corpus tracked by ReadingList. Margaret Peterson Haddix's books are assigned across grades 2 through 8, with Lexile measures spanning varying Lexile bands. Within this canon, Running Out of Time and Among the Hidden are Margaret Peterson Haddix's most-cited titles across state ELA framework documents and AP/IB syllabus audits — they appear on multiple state Department of Education reading lists and in Common Core Appendix B exemplar references.

For parents and teachers researching Margaret Peterson Haddix for the first time, the practical question is usually grade placement and theme fit. Use the Lexile range (varying Lexile bands) as a first filter: a Lexile measure 100-200L above a student's current reading level is the typical instructional sweet spot for guided classroom reading, while a measure at or below the student's level supports independent reading.
